The original mixed-media artwork titled "Banksy Thrower" by Mr Brainwash measures 16 x 20 inches and showcases a dynamic homage to the iconic stencil by Banksy. The central figure is a masked protester in a throwing stance, clutching a book titled Art for Dummies, which replaces the traditional item associated with Banksy’s original artwork. Surrounding the figure is a vibrant collage of bold graffiti-inspired text, pop art motifs, and layered imagery. The words “Life is Beautiful” in striking red dominate the upper portion of the piece, while “Never Never Never Give Up!” in blue and “Keep It Real” in red provide messages of hope and authenticity. Bright colours, including yellow, green, and pink, drip and splash across the canvas, merging with imagery like Campbell’s soup cans and abstract patterns to create a chaotic yet energising composition.
Mr Brainwash, born Thierry Guetta, is a French street and pop artist who gained global acclaim after collaborating with Banksy on the 2010 documentary Exit Through the Gift Shop. Known for his fearless creativity and uplifting messages, Mr Brainwash combines street art, pop culture, and vibrant aesthetics to captivate audiences. His debut exhibition, Life is Beautiful, solidified his place in the contemporary art world, and his works continue to inspire positivity and creativity worldwide.
